    About this experience

    There are some places you can’t help but fall in love at first sight, and Cassis is part of them ! Spend some free time at leisure in the charming fishermen port. Enjoy the local market on Wednesday and friday. Possibility to join a cruise to discover the Calanques (cruise ticket not included). Discover the Luberon area in the afternoon with some of the most beautiful villages in France : Lourmarin, Roussillon and Gordes. This full day tour will return to Aix in the middle of the day. The company cannot be held responsible if the Calanques cruise is cancelled due to bad weather or if the Crest road and the access to Cap Canaille are closed (no refund can be claimed).

    What you'll see and do

    1. Cassis

      Enjoy your morning in Cassis - possibility to join a 1 hour cruise to see the Calanques (not included). The company cannot be held responsible if the Calanques cruise is cancelled due to bad weather or if the Crest road and the access to Cap Canaille are closed (no refund can be claimed).

      180 minutes here

    2. Aix-en-Provence

      This full day tour will return to Aix in the middle of the day. Free time for a quick snack.

      30 minutes here

    3. Lourmarin

      Free time in the village

      60 minutes here

    4. Bonnieux

      Photo stop

      20 minutes here

    5. Roussillon

      Free time in the village

      60 minutes here

    6. Gordes

      Stroll in the village

      45 minutes here
